BACKGROUND The property is located approximately '/z mile outside the city limits, but within the city's planning jurisdiction which has not been zoned. As part of the Board's action authorizing a sewer tie -on for the site, staff was directed to develop an extraterritorial zoning plan and zone the 4.46 acres. Staff reviewed the land use plan for the area and determined that a change from single family to commercial is reasonable for the northeast corner of Arch Street Pike and Dixon Road. Therefore, staff feels that a C-3 reclassification at the intersection of a principal arterial, Arch Street Pike, and collector, Dixon Road, is appropriate. Staff also supports including the OS area to help buffer the England Acres Subdivision from the proposed commercial development. The C-3 rezoning of the site is the final step in the process to extend the city's zoning jurisdiction to the property in question. BACKGROUND The property in question, 4.46 acres, is located within the city's planning jurisdiction, but in an area which the city has not zoned and is only exercising subdivision controls. Recently, the property owner requested permission to tie -on to an existing sewer main and the Board authorized the tie -on by Resolution No. 10,291. The resolution also expressed the city's intent to exercise zoning jurisdiction in the area and directed staff to develop an extraterritorial zoning plan and zone the 4.46 acres at the northeast corner of Arch Street Pike and Dixon Road. The PARTICIPATION proposal has been reviewed by the staff and the Little Rock Wastewater. BACKGROUND Sewer service is available from an existing force main located outside of the city limits. The Board's policy is not to extend sewer service outside the corporate limits without its prior approval. The sma 1 force main was extended many years ago prior to implementation of the Board's current policy. The staff has consistency discouraged the extension of any sewer service to property that did not annex first. This property is not adjacent to the city limits and, therefore, cannot annex. Sewer service, for the most part, is contained entirely within the city limits. Finally, extension of sewer service outside the corporate limits sets a dangerous precedent that could result in significant urbanization adjacent to but outside the city's corporate limits.
